Main Entry: tortuous
Part of Speech: adjective
Definition: very twisted

Synonyms:

anfractuous, bent, circuitous, convoluted, crooked, curved, flexuous, indirect, involute, labyrinthine, mazy, meandering, meandrous, roundabout, serpentine, sinuous, snaky, twisting, vermiculate, winding, zigzag
Notes: tortuous is 'winding, crooked, full of twists and turns' and torturous (based on 'torture') is 'painful, characterized by suffering'

Antonyms:

direct, straight, untwisted

Main Entry: complex
Part of Speech: adjective
Definition: involved, intricate

Synonyms:

circuitous, complicated, composite, compound, compounded, confused, conglomerate, convoluted, elaborate, entangled, heterogeneous, knotty, labyrinthine, manifold, mingled, miscellaneous, mixed, mixed-up, mosaic, motley, multifarious, multiform, multiple, multiplex, tangled, tortuous, variegated
Notes: something complex may be well-organized and logically constructed as well as subtle and intricate, while a thing that is complicated will have something irregular, perverse, asymmetrical in addition to fundamental intricacy; complex is more formal and technical (a problem in mathematics is complex) while something like personal life can be complicated

Antonyms:

clear, easy, evident, homogeneous, obvious, plain, simple, uniform
